Betty Crocker Sugar Cookie Mix Recipe
Ingredients
- 1 package of Betty Crocker Sugar Cookie Mix
- 1/2 cup (1 stick) of unsalted butter, softened
- 1 egg
- 1 tablespoon of all-purpose flour (for rolling)
Instructions
- Preheat the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(180°C). Ensure your oven rack is in the middle position.
- Mix the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the softened unsalted butter, egg, and the entire package of Betty Crocker Sugar Cookie Mix. Use a wooden spoon or an electric mixer set to low speed to mix until a dough forms. It should come together easily and be slightly sticky.
- Prepare for Rolling: Sprinkle a clean surface with the tablespoon of all-purpose flour. This will prevent the dough from sticking when you roll it out.
- Roll the Dough: Place the cookie dough on the floured surface and gently knead it a few times to bring it together. Roll out the dough to your desired thickness, typically about 1/4 inch (0.6 cm) thick.
- Cut Shapes: Use cookie cutters to cut out your desired shapes from the rolled dough. This is where you can get creative, making anything from classic round cookies to intricate shapes for holidays or special occasions.
- Place on Baking Sheets: Carefully transfer the cut-out cookies onto ungreased baking sheets. Leave some space between each cookie to allow for spreading during baking.
- Bake: Slide the baking sheets into the preheated oven and bake for 7 to 9 minutes, or until the edges of the cookies turn a light golden brown. Be cautious not to overbake; remember that cookies continue to cook slightly after being removed from the oven.
- Cool and Decorate: Once baked, rem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to wire racks to cool completely. Once cooled, unleash your creativity by decorating with icing, sprinkles, or your favorite toppings.
Tips for the Best Sugar Cookies
- Quality Ingredients: Use fresh, high-quality ingredients, especially when it comes to the butter and egg. Fresh ingredients will yield the best flavor and texture.
- Uniform Thickness: Roll the dough to a uniform thickness to ensure even baking. Using guides like rolling pin rings can help achieve this.
- Chilled Dough: If the dough becomes too soft or sticky while working with it, place it in the refrigerator for about 15 minutes to firm up.
- Room Temperature Butter: Make sure your butter is softened to room temperature before mixing it with the other ingredients. This allows for better incorporation into the dough.
